Transaction 3ceeba610d45d0858bc6cc0ddbd71a50233c3f5b123a2e98f18c31dd7262de49

block
c54bf22bb9ae7cb541a3468df8f3ff4565d9a5db98b83fc94d049c937d4960cc

1 Input

23 Outputs